Wall Water Damage Repair Cost In Winstead Park, ID
The cost of Wall Water Damage Rep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Winstead Park, ID. Est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air. What affects cost? The sever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$100 – $300 | The extent of the damage and the complexity of the assessment. |
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ed. |
| Structural Drying and Cleanup |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air. |
| Final Inspection and Sanitizing | $200 – $500 | The complexity of the final inspection and the sanitizing treatment required. |
| Follow-up and Warranty | $100 – $200 | The number of follow-up visits and the warranty provided. |
